Copyright © 2026 chelsea.yabsta.co.uk All Right Reserved
powered by
5th Floor, 8 Cork St. Westminster Abbey, London, United Kingdom, W1S 3LJ
10 Leigham Drv. Isleworth, Greater London, United Kingdom, TW7 5LU
Basement, 10 Queensborough Terrace Westminster Abbey, London, United Kingdom, W2 3TB
9 North Hyde Rd. Hayes, Greater London, United Kingdom, UB3 4NJ
100 Pall Mall Westminster Abbey, London, United Kingdom, SW1Y 5NQ
271 Regent St. Westminster Abbey, London, United Kingdom, W1B 2ES
10 Livonia St. Westminster Abbey, London, United Kingdom, W1F 8AF
Unit 19, Windsor Prk. Industrial Estate, 50 Windsor Ave. Merton, London, United Kingdom, SW19 2TJ
Onslow Crst. Kensington, London, United Kingdom, SW7 3JH
163-173 Praed St. Westminster Abbey, London, United Kingdom, W2 1RH